By Sadiq Umar, Abuja.

President Muhammadu Buhari Tuesday charged warring groups within his ruling All Progressive Congress (APC) to bury the hatchet for the sake of Nigeria, just as party chieftain, Mr. Bola Tinubu pledged his loyalty to the president.

APC had been engulfed in internal crisis following disagreement among its leaders over National Assembly leadership.

Buhari , after what seems like an intractable wrangling, Tuesday night  invited some of the leaders to join him at the breaking of Ramadan fast at the Presidential Villa, Abuja where he spoke.

 

He appealed to the leaders of the party to sheath their swords for the sake of the country, urging them to stomach their pains and brushes in order to move the country forward.

 

“We should just look at Nigeria as Nigerians, no matter the level you are, loss your influence so that we can help achieve the manifestos – security, economy, employment and corruption because if we don’t kill corruption, corruption will kill Nigeria. We have to ensure that people we bring forward are those that will move the society forward,” he warned.

 

He reminded them of the party’s journey to victory saying he almost give up on the possibility of winning at a point, but for the coming together of the leaders to form a formidable opposition to the then ruling party.

 

At the occasion which is the first public meeting between President Buhari and Tinubu since the crisis started in the party, Buhari told his guests that for the party to deliver on its campaign promises, the leaders needed to resolve their differences.

 

“I always like to go down memory lane to show how lucky we are as a political group.

 

“At no stage was the decision taken by chance it was all deliberate. The leaders of the parties felt the only way to wrestle power from the PDP was for us to come together. I in particular was scared after previous failures of the elections of 2003, 2007 and 2011.

 

“We dissolved our various parties to form APC then we applied to INEC, for once I was grateful to INEC. We had gone with nine people to INEC to apply and INEC advised us that we needed at least 25 people across the people to form a political party. We were able to go back raised 35 members across the country and then successfully registered the party.

“INEC then informed the federal government that we have met the requirements hence we cannot be denied registration. Many doubting Thomases said merger has never succeeded in Nigeria but here we are.

 

“I went into this long explanation so that you will appreciate how far we have come and for a society as ours, if we respect the constitution, then all the greed and problems will be a thing of the fast.

 

APC Chieftain and former governor of Lagos, Bola Tinubu‎, expressed appreciation to the president for the invitation for the fast breaking.

 

He lambasted the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) and other critics who accused the Buhari’s administration of inaction and delay in delivering on the change he promised Nigerians.

 

Tinubu said the 16-years ‎mess of the PDP cannot be automatically cleaned up in 30 days.

‎Both men spoke at the breaking of Ramadan fast at the new Banquet Hall at the Presidential Villa late last night.

 

He pledged total support to the government of the day, assuring President Buhari of success in office.

 

“We believe this diversity will continue to propel us for economic growth under your leadership.

 

“This is the first Ramadan after the election. We thank God for cutting down the opponents 60 years of fake promises to 16 years.

 

“I heard they say we are slow. Yes, we didn’t campaign to be fire fighters, but planners and meticulous one at that. A latrine pit of 16 years can’t be cleaned up in 30 days because the mess is much.

 

“Mr. President you started well, you hit the ground running. You promised Nigerians that you’ll address security and your first meeting to ECOWAS was on security because we cannot fight alone.

 

“You have been to others places. If they think is a game of ludo, we will say is serious business. If they forgot G7 we will remind them.

 

“We have faith in you Mr. President. We have faith in your capacity and uprightness. I’m here filled up and not fed up.

 

“We promise to continue to be with you and support. ‎No matter what they are saying we are not re-running the election until four years time.

 

“We pray to God to give us four more years of this month and pray to Him to forgive our misdeeds, and for peace and stability, with this Nigeria i‎s a promise to the future.

 

“Mr. President, your hands are on the plough and you will succeed‎”, he added.

 

The ceremony attracted the presence of APC national publicity secretary, Mr. Lai Mohammadu,  Mr Audu Ogbe, former Governor of Rivers state, Rotimi Amaechi, Senator Olorunnimbe Mamora, amongst others.
